Bug 2292443

Summary: [abrt] obs-studio: obs killed by SIGSEGV
Product: [Fedora] Fedora Reporter: gigli <gigli>
Component: obs-studioAssignee: Neal Gompa <ngompa13>
Status: CLOSED ERRATA QA Contact:
Severity: unspecified Docs Contact:
Priority: unspecified    
Version: 40CC: dominik, gigli, jgrulich, marcdeop, multimedia-sig, ngompa13
Target Milestone: ---   
Target Release: ---   
Hardware: x86_64   
OS: Unspecified   
Whiteboard: abrt_hash:882f41913d0f22987619a88e3dafc9c90c784183;VARIANT_ID=kde;
Fixed In Version: obs-studio-30.2.2-1.fc40 Doc Type: ---
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2024-08-04 02:18:21 UTC Type: ---
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:
Attachments:
Description Flags
File: proc_pid_status
none
File: maps
none
File: limits
none
File: environ
none
File: open_fds
none
File: mountinfo
none
File: os_info
none
File: cpuinfo
none
File: core_backtrace
none
File: exploitable
none
File: dso_list
none
File: var_log_messages
none
File: backtrace none

Description gigli 2024-06-14 19:40:53 UTC
Description of problem:
install the lsp-plugins-vst plugins and try to use it on OBS

Version-Release number of selected component:
obs-studio-30.1.1-2.fc40

Additional info:
reporter:       libreport-2.17.15
type:           CCpp
reason:         obs killed by SIGSEGV
journald_cursor: s=edf721d4130f43ad8b2ea3d55a36f123;i=119be6;b=636a068bc077493199897ce8483dfbee;m=5b4fefb5;t=61ade68fab11e;x=b01422e26f92c5c0
executable:     /usr/bin/obs
cmdline:        /usr/bin/obs
cgroup:         0::/user.slice/user-1000.slice/user/app.slice/app-com.obsproject.Studio
rootdir:        /
uid:            1000
kernel:         6.8.11-300.fc40.x86_64
package:        obs-studio-30.1.1-2.fc40
runlevel:       N 5
backtrace_rating: 3
comment:        install the lsp-plugins-vst plugins and try to use it on OBS

Truncated backtrace:
Thread no. 1 (17 frames)
 #0 ??
 #1 VSTPlugin::process at /usr/src/debug/obs-studio-30.1.1-2.fc40.x86_64/plugins/obs-vst/VSTPlugin.cpp:273
 #2 vst_filter_audio at /usr/src/debug/obs-studio-30.1.1-2.fc40.x86_64/plugins/obs-vst/obs-vst.cpp:167
 #3 filter_async_audio at /usr/src/debug/obs-studio-30.1.1-2.fc40.x86_64/libobs/obs-source.c:4048
 #4 obs_source_output_audio at /usr/src/debug/obs-studio-30.1.1-2.fc40.x86_64/libobs/obs-source.c:4236
 #5 pulse_stream_read at /usr/src/debug/obs-studio-30.1.1-2.fc40.x86_64/plugins/linux-pulseaudio/pulse-input.c:218
 #6 pstream_memblock_callback at ../src/pulse/context.c:441
 #7 memblock_complete at ../src/pulsecore/pstream.c:852
 #8 do_read at ../src/pulsecore/pstream.c:1014
 #9 do_pstream_read_write at ../src/pulsecore/pstream.c:261
 #10 dispatch_pollfds at ../src/pulse/mainloop.c:676
 #11 pa_mainloop_dispatch at ../src/pulse/mainloop.c:917
 #12 pa_mainloop_iterate at ../src/pulse/mainloop.c:948
 #13 pa_mainloop_run at ../src/pulse/mainloop.c:963
 #14 thread at ../src/pulse/thread-mainloop.c:101
 #15 internal_thread_func at ../src/pulsecore/thread-posix.c:81
 #17 clone3 at ../sysdeps/unix/sysv/linux/x86_64/clone3.S:78

Comment 1 gigli 2024-06-14 19:40:55 UTC
Created attachment 2037358 [details]
File: proc_pid_status

Comment 2 gigli 2024-06-14 19:40:57 UTC
Created attachment 2037359 [details]
File: maps

Comment 3 gigli 2024-06-14 19:40:58 UTC
Created attachment 2037360 [details]
File: limits

Comment 4 gigli 2024-06-14 19:41:00 UTC
Created attachment 2037361 [details]
File: environ

Comment 5 gigli 2024-06-14 19:41:01 UTC
Created attachment 2037362 [details]
File: open_fds

Comment 6 gigli 2024-06-14 19:41:02 UTC
Created attachment 2037363 [details]
File: mountinfo

Comment 7 gigli 2024-06-14 19:41:03 UTC
Created attachment 2037364 [details]
File: os_info

Comment 8 gigli 2024-06-14 19:41:05 UTC
Created attachment 2037365 [details]
File: cpuinfo

Comment 9 gigli 2024-06-14 19:41:06 UTC
Created attachment 2037366 [details]
File: core_backtrace

Comment 10 gigli 2024-06-14 19:41:08 UTC
Created attachment 2037367 [details]
File: exploitable

Comment 11 gigli 2024-06-14 19:41:09 UTC
Created attachment 2037368 [details]
File: dso_list

Comment 12 gigli 2024-06-14 19:41:10 UTC
Created attachment 2037369 [details]
File: var_log_messages

Comment 13 gigli 2024-06-14 19:41:12 UTC
Created attachment 2037370 [details]
File: backtrace

Comment 14 Fedora Update System 2024-08-01 02:34:57 UTC
FEDORA-2024-a2b5f3b2a1 (obs-studio-30.2.2-1.fc40) has been submitted as an update to Fedora 40.
https://bodhi.fedoraproject.org/updates/FEDORA-2024-a2b5f3b2a1

Comment 15 Fedora Update System 2024-08-02 03:39:50 UTC
FEDORA-2024-a2b5f3b2a1 has been pushed to the Fedora 40 testing repository.
Soon you'll be able to install the update with the following command:
`sudo dnf upgrade --enablerepo=updates-testing --refresh --advisory=FEDORA-2024-a2b5f3b2a1`
You can provide feedback for this update here: https://bodhi.fedoraproject.org/updates/FEDORA-2024-a2b5f3b2a1

See also https://fedoraproject.org/wiki/QA:Updates_Testing for more information on how to test updates.

Comment 16 Fedora Update System 2024-08-04 02:18:21 UTC
FEDORA-2024-a2b5f3b2a1 (obs-studio-30.2.2-1.fc40) has been pushed to the Fedora 40 stable repository.
If problem still persists, please make note of it in this bug report.